Lesley University seeks a Core Faculty member and Coordinator of the School & Community Programs who will teach courses in the master's and doctoral programs in Counseling and Psychology and provide academic leadership for the School Counseling and School & Community programs. Reporting to the Associate Provost for Mental Health and Wellbeing and working closely with the Department Chair, this faculty member will provide academic leadership for the School & Community specialization while teaching in the master's and doctoral programs. The successful candidate will help prepare students for Massachusetts licensure as School Counselors, School Adjustment Counselors, and Licensed Mental Health Counselors, while advancing a program grounded in social justice, trauma-informed practice, culturally responsive counseling, and partnerships between schools, families, and communities. This role includes teaching graduate courses, advising and mentoring students, contributing to curriculum and program development, engaging in scholarship, participating in departmental and university service, and supporting accreditation and licensure requirements. The faculty member will collaborate with the Associate Provost, Department Chair, and student success staff to strengthen student learning, faculty development, and the continued growth of the School & Community specialization.
